/**
* PSServer PSServer.js file.
* This plugin is a server based persistent storage backend.
*/
(function() {
var PSServer = window.PSServer = function PSServer(editor) {
this.editor = editor;
}
PSServer._pluginInfo = {
name : "PSServer",
version : "2.0",
developer : "Douglas Mayle",
developer_url : "http://xinha.org",
license : "MIT"
};
PSServer.prototype.onGenerateOnce = function () {
// We use _loadConfig to asynchronously load the config and then register the
// backend.
this._loadConfig();
};
PSServer.prototype._loadConfig = function() {
var self = this;
if (!this._serverConfig) {
Xinha._getback(Xinha.getPluginDir("PSServer") + "/config.inc.php",
function(config) {
self._serverConfig = eval('(' + config + ')');
self._serverConfig.user_affinity = 20;
self._serverConfig.displayName = 'Server';
self._loadConfig();
});
return;
}
this._registerBackend();
}
PSServer.prototype._registerBackend = function(timeWaited) {
var editor = this.editor;
var self = this;
if (!timeWaited) {
timeWaited = 0;
}
// Retry over a period of ten seconds to register. We back off exponentially
// to limit resouce usage in the case of misconfiguration.
var registerTimeout = 10000;
if (timeWaited > registerTimeout) {
// This is most likely a configuration error. We're loaded and
// PersistentStorage is not.
return;
}
if (!editor.plugins['PersistentStorage'] ||
!editor.plugins['PersistentStorage'].instance ||
!editor.plugins['PersistentStorage'].instance.ready) {
window.setTimeout(function() {self._registerBackend(timeWaited ? timeWaited*2 : 50);}, timeWaited ? timeWaited : 50);
return;
}
editor.plugins['PersistentStorage'].instance.registerBackend('PSServer', this, this._serverConfig);
}
